Goodbye Guns N' Roses : The Crime, Beauty, and Amplified Chaos of America's Most Polarizing Band
Guns N' Roses - Book - by Art Tavana
(2021)
Goodbye, Guns N Roses is a genre-rattling attempt to explain the appeal of Americas most divisive rock band. While it includes uncharted history and the self-lacerating connoisseurship of a Guns N Roses fetishist, it is not a recycled chronicle this book is a deconstruction of myth, one that blends high and low art sketches to examine how Guns N Roses impacted popular culture. Unlike those who have penned other treatments of what might be considered a clichéd subject, Art Tavana is not writing as a GNR patriot or former employee. His book aims to provide an untethered exploration that machetes through the jungle of propaganda camouflaging GNRs explosive appeal.
After circling the bands three-decade plundering of American culture, Goodbye, Guns N Roses uncovers a postmodern portrait that persuades its viewer to think differently about their symbolic importance. This is not a rock bio but a biography of taste that treats a former hair metal band like a decomposing masterpiece. This is the first Guns N Roses book written for everyone; from the Sunset Strip to a hyper-digital generations connection to Woke Axl, it is a pop investigation that dodges no bullets.
